NSQ is a distributed, brokerless messaging platform designed for high-throughput, fault-tolerant communication. By utilizing a decentralized topology, it eliminates single points of failure and allows for horizontal scaling across clusters. The system organizes message streams into topics and channels, effectively decoupling producers from consumers to support both streaming and job-oriented workloads. The platform distinguishes itself through a lookup-service-based discovery mechanism that enables clients to dynamically locate producers at runtime without requiring centralized coordination.
Implements a custom binary protocol over persistent TCP connections for efficient data multiplexing.
Sonic is a high-performance, lightweight search backend designed to provide real-time full-text search and autocomplete capabilities for applications. It functions as a persistent indexing server that maps text terms to object identifiers, allowing developers to integrate rapid search functionality without storing raw document content directly within the search engine. The system distinguishes itself through a specialized graph-based index that enables real-time word prediction and typo correction. Sarama is a Go client library for producing and consuming messages from Apache Kafka clusters. It provides dedicated interfaces for a message producer to send typed data packets and a message consumer to read and process continuous data streams from Kafka topics. The library includes a mocking framework and simulation layer that mimics Kafka broker behavior. These tools allow for the testing of client applications and messaging logic without requiring a live cluster. Iggy is a distributed message streaming platform and multi-protocol message broker that functions as a persistent distributed log store. It provides infrastructure for publishing and consuming binary messages using an append-only log, ensuring high availability and data consistency across nodes through Viewstamped Replication. The platform is distinguished by its specialized LLM streaming infrastructure, which uses a server protocol to connect large language models to streaming data and system controls. amqp.node is a Node.js client and asynchronous messaging middleware designed for communicating with message brokers using the AMQP 0-9-1 protocol. It enables the creation of decoupled, event-driven architectures where independent components exchange data via queues and exchanges. The library features a multiplexed channel manager that operates multiple logical communication streams over a single persistent connection.
